A GM 6.2L V8 engine submerged in a river for four years has been recovered and examined, revealing extensive corrosion and structural damage. The discovery underscores the long-term impact of water exposure on vehicle engines and raises concerns about the durability of flood-damaged vehicles.

The engine, recovered from a riverbed after being submerged for four years, shows severe corrosion on metal components, including cylinders, pistons, and internal passages, according to preliminary inspections by automotive experts. The engine was part of a vehicle that was likely flooded and subsequently abandoned, with the waterlogged environment accelerating corrosion processes.

Experts involved in the examination noted that the engine’s internal parts, including the crankshaft and valves, exhibited rust and pitting, rendering many components unusable. The investigation was initiated after local reports of a submerged vehicle, which was later identified as containing the GM 6.2L V8 engine.

Long-Term Effects of Water on Automotive Engines

The 6.2L V8 engine in question is a common powertrain in GM trucks and SUVs. While short-term water exposure can sometimes be mitigated with thorough cleaning and repairs, prolonged submersion, such as four years in a river, typically causes irreversible damage. Previous studies and reports have documented engine failures after flooding, but few have examined engines after such an extended period submerged in natural water bodies.

This incident follows increasing concerns about climate change and flooding, which lead to more vehicles being submerged for long durations. The findings from this engine provide a rare, real-world case of what happens to a high-performance engine after years underwater.

“The extent of rust and pitting on this engine is extraordinary. After four years submerged, most internal components are compromised beyond repair.”

— John Smith, automotive corrosion specialist

Key Questions

Can a flooded engine like this be repaired?

Most likely, the extensive corrosion makes repair impractical. Many internal parts are severely rusted, and restoring functionality would require replacing most components.

What does this mean for vehicles in flood-prone areas?

This underscores the importance of proper vehicle disposal or thorough inspection after flooding to prevent safety risks from compromised engines.

How long does water damage typically affect an engine?

Short-term water exposure can sometimes be mitigated, but prolonged submersion, especially over years, usually causes irreversible damage, as seen in this case.

Will this affect GM engine warranties or recalls?

Warranties generally do not cover flood damage, and this case highlights the need for careful assessment of flood-damaged vehicles before repair or resale.
